CARA INPUT DATA DARI EXCEL KE EST

Membuat website yang berkualitas tidak hanya tergantung pada tampilannya yang menarik, tetapi juga dari kualitas data yang dimasukkan ke dalamnya. Dalam kebanyakan kasus, data yang dimasukkan ke dalam website berasal dari inputan pengguna. Oleh karena itu, penting bagi setiap developer untuk memahami cara input data dari form ke dalam website.

Input Data dari Form ke Website Menggunakan PHP dan MySQL

Ada banyak cara untuk memasukkan data dari form ke dalam website, tetapi dalam artikel ini kita akan menggunakan bahasa scripting PHP dan database MySQL. PHP merupakan bahasa pemrograman yang populer digunakan dalam pengembangan website, sedangkan MySQL adalah sistem manajemen database relasional yang sering digunakan bersama PHP.

Cara Input Data Dari Form Dengan PHP MySQL

Berikut adalah langkah-langkah untuk menginput data ke dalam website menggunakan PHP dan MySQL:

  1. Membuat form HTML
  2. Pertama, kita perlu membuat form HTML yang akan digunakan untuk menginput data ke dalam website. Form HTML terdiri dari tag <form> yang mengindikasikan awal dan akhir dari form, dan berbagai jenis input seperti text, password, checkbox, radio button, dan sebagainya.

    CARA INPUT DATA DARI EXCEL KE EST

    Dalam contoh di atas, kita memiliki dua inputan field, yaitu nama dan email, yang akan dimasukkan ke dalam tabel “users” pada database MySQL.

  3. Mengirim data form dengan metode POST
  4. Setelah form HTML dibuat, perlu ditentukan bagaimana data yang dimasukkan ke dalam form dapat dikirimkan ke dalam script PHP yang akan memprosesnya. Salah satu metode pengiriman data yang paling umum adalah dengan metode POST. Dalam metode POST, data yang dimasukkan oleh pengguna akan dikirim secara terpisah ke dalam script PHP.

    Untuk menggunakan metode POST, kita perlu menambahkan atribut method="POST" pada tag form HTML, seperti contoh di atas.

  5. Memproses data form dengan script PHP
  6. Setelah data form telah dikirim menggunakan metode POST, kita perlu mengambil data form tersebut dan menyimpannya ke dalam database MySQL. Hal ini dilakukan dengan membuat script PHP yang akan memproses data form.

    Berikut adalah contoh script PHP untuk mengambil data nama dan email dari form HTML dan menyimpannya ke dalam tabel “users” pada database MySQL:

    <?php
          $dbhost = 'localhost';
          $dbuser = 'root';
          $dbpass = '';
          $dbname = 'mydatabase';
          $conn = mysqli_connect($dbhost, $dbuser, $dbpass, $dbname);
          if(! $conn )
              die('Could not connect: ' . mysqli_error());
         
          if(isset($_POST['submit']))
              $name = mysqli_real_escape_string($conn, $_POST['name']);
              $email = mysqli_real_escape_string($conn, $_POST['email']);
              $sql = "INSERT INTO users (name, email) VALUES ('$name', '$email')";
              if(mysqli_query($conn, $sql))
                 echo "Data berhasil dimasukkan ke dalam database";
              else
                 echo "Terjadi kesalahan: " . mysqli_error($conn);
             
         
    mysqli_close($conn);
    ?>

    Dalam contoh di atas, kita mengambil data nama dan email yang dikirimkan dari form HTML menggunakan metode POST, dan menyimpannya ke dalam tabel “users” pada database MySQL. Koneksi ke database MySQL dilakukan menggunakan fungsi mysqli_connect(), sedangkan query untuk menyimpan data dilakukan menggunakan fungsi mysqli_query().

  7. Menampilkan data dari database
  8. Setelah data berhasil dimasukkan ke dalam database, kita dapat menampilkan data yang telah dimasukkan ke dalam website. Untuk menampilkan data dari database MySQL, kita dapat membuat script PHP yang akan mengambil data dari database dan menampilkannya sebagai tabel HTML.

    Contoh Tampilan Data dari Database

    Dalam contoh di atas, kita menggunakan fungsi mysqli_query() untuk mengambil semua data dari tabel “users” pada database MySQL, dan menampilkannya sebagai tabel HTML menggunakan tag <table>, <tr>, dan <td>.

FAQ

1. Apa bedanya metode POST dan metode GET dalam pengiriman data form?

Metode POST dan GET adalah dua metode yang berbeda dalam pengiriman data form dari client ke server. Metode GET mengirimkan data melalui URL yang terbuka dan dapat dibaca oleh siapapun, sedangkan metode POST mengirimkan data secara terpisah dan lebih aman karena tidak terlihat oleh pengguna website.

Baca Juga :  Cara Membuat Daftar Santri Di Excel

2. Apa yang harus dilakukan jika data yang dimasukkan gagal disimpan ke dalam database?

Jika data yang dimasukkan oleh pengguna gagal disimpan ke dalam database, biasanya disebabkan oleh kesalahan dalam penulisan syntax SQL. Oleh karena itu, pastikan bahwa query yang digunakan untuk menyimpan data telah ditulis dengan benar dan sesuai dengan struktur tabel pada database MySQL. Jika masih mengalami kendala, periksa log error pada server dan konsultasikan dengan tim pengembang website.

Video di atas adalah tutorial dasar tentang cara input data dari form ke dalam website menggunakan PHP dan MySQL.